在C語言中,可以使用printf函數的格式化輸出來實現右對齊。具體步驟如下:
以下是一個示例代碼,實現輸出一個右對齊的數字:
#include <stdio.h>
int main() {
int number = 1234;
int width = 8; // 輸出的寬度為8
printf("%*d\n", width, number);
return 0;
}
以上代碼會輸出:
1234
其中,數字1234被右對齊輸出,并且前面補了3個空格。